In recent discussions among players, the art of revealing cards at showdown is generating strong debate. Some believe it enhances gameplay while others maintain strategic secrets should remain hidden. This divide shapes player interaction and strategies at the tables.

The Surprising Benefits of Showing Your Hand

Experience from the felt showcases that revealing your cards can lead to unexpected victories. Players have reported gaining advantages simply by showing their hands at showdown. As one contributor noted, โ€œI won a huge pot with A high flush draw because my opponent misread my hand.โ€ This demonstrates how revealing hands can pressure opponents and potentially make them fold their better hands.

Why Confidence Matters at the Table

Comments from users on various forums solidify the value of confidence in revealing hands:

  • Avoiding Misunderstandings: Players often find themselves in disputes about whose hand wins. One player recalled a frustrating incident where their opponent flashed pocket kings on an ace-high board, only to realize they had the winning hand after mucking.

  • Gaining Information: Some players prefer to show their hand last, saying it provides them with critical information about opponentsโ€™ strategies.

  • Encouraging Engagement: "Poker is more fun when you donโ€™t care what others think!" emphasizes the shift in mindset that can lead to a more relaxed and enjoyable game.
